Want to Loop your YouTube Videos?

Haven't you ever wondered why YouTube didn't have a 'Repeat' button so that you could play your favourite videos over and over again? I'm sure you have that's why you've come here.

Seems like Google just doesn't want YouTube to become another Music JukeBox. But guess what, you still can have continuous playback for YouTube videos, thanks to this cool website I found, http://www.youtubeloop.com.

This site does exactly what it's name says. It allows you to loop any YouTube video that you enter in it. All you have to do is add the YouTube Video URL to the text box and the site will do the rest.

They also let you download YouTube videos, which is cool, but lots of other ways to do that.

Getting the 'Taskbar has been disabled by Administrator' error?

I was getting this one too. It was due to a virus blocking my access to the task bar. I didn't disable it myself and I am the administrator of my own computer (obvious).

So I found this site that has a neat fix for it. First you have to make a clean sweep of any viruses using a good anti-virus software. Then you have to run the following command in the run function. The one in the start bar menu.

Mind you, I'm using Windows Xp Service Pack 2. Haven't tested it on any other system.

So the command is simple,

REG add HKCU\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Policies\System /v DisableTaskMgr /t REG_DWORD /d 0 /f

All you have to do is copy paste that code and run it in the run menu. That fixed it for me.

For further help, visit this page, where I got my help from, http://windowsxp.mvps.org/Taskmanager_error.htm

Changing domain names really isn't a good idea for SEO

If you have a domain name that you've been running for a year or two and suddenly feel the urge to change the name because it's cooler or for any other reason whatsoever then you should know it's not a good SEO move.

All links urls have a google page rank and alexa rating history. The more people explore and 'hit' those urls / pages is the more it's going to look better on your Page Rank and Alexa rating score. Meaning it's just going well for you since more and more people keep finding your page.

I'd like to talk about an example a website I follow every now and then. It's Ytkpro.com. Recently it's alexa rating has really declined to minimal levels. It should only be going up since they have a decent level of visitors on their forums.

I'll show the recent graph,



They got a new domain for their forums it seems and redirected old domain name, 'forum.ytkpro.com' to ytk.smfnew.com. This has made a huge decline in their normal hits for the real website 'ytkpro.com'. So it's going off the search engine charts as it seems while the other bogus domain name is gaining air.

It's like taking the life out of domain name. 99% of their traffic was linked to ytkpro.com through their forum.

Using two or more domain names isn't a bad idea. Proper way of using them is to redirect new domain names to the old and the parent domain name so that it stays up. Which is the point of SEO.
